Transaction 570527c7c4f6cf72e9b897de6724f26ef1a7673463d9bdbffffc86a760b3b3b1

5 Input
2 Outputs
  • 570527c7c4f6cf72e9b897de6724f26ef1a7673463d9bdbffffc86a760b3b3b1:0
  • value  1355800000
    address  1LbUzaG4cbSXwAygThXN9ghAHvdK8BcShu
  • 570527c7c4f6cf72e9b897de6724f26ef1a7673463d9bdbffffc86a760b3b3b1:1
  • value  3205284598
    address  1Hu3JokTLS2t6HsfBKEstsNGwZHqgqTuvL